Household of Nicolaus Bernardi Speekenbrink

He is married to Maria Aertse Arnoldi Baerten.

They were married in church on February 23, 1727 at Oosterhout.


Child(ren):

  1. Bernardus Speekenbrink  ± 1727-± 1795
